The Costs of Failure in the Hiring Process
Want to save time and money quickly? How about grow your business sustainability? Hiring the right people makes all the difference and the following infographic illustrates the potential costs of failure. Call WIN Sales & Marketing today and we’ll help you set-up a proper screening process in minutes…